MG India has started bookings for the ZS EV Excite variant from today. The base model is priced at ₹22.58 lakh and gets a new Ivory White interior theme. This variant was announced in March when the EV was launched, however, it was not on sale until now. MG has recently increased the prices of the ZS EV with the Excite variant increasing by ₹59,000 while the Exclusive variant has increased by ₹61,800.

The base Excite variant comes with a 25.7-inch HD touchscreen with Park+ Native app for parking booking, MapmyIndia online navigation system with live traffic, live weather and AQI, and integrated Discover app for locating nearby restaurants and hotels. Is. The system also comes with firmware over-the-air (FOTA) update capability. It also gets 360 degree parking camera, digital key, push button start/stop, automatic climate control, fully digital instrument cluster and hill descent control. The design and features of the base variant will remain the same as the top-end exclusive variant.
Coming to the looks, the MG ZS EV facelift includes a revised front fascia. Being an EV, the front grille is completely closed and now gets full LED hockey headlamps with LED DRLs to accentuate the visuals. On the side are 17-inch tomahawk hub design alloy wheels which are different from Astor. The rear has LED tail lamps and a faux skid plate. The charging port is enclosed behind the front grill. It is available in red, silver, gray and black colors. The 2022 MG ZS EV offers an improved range of 461 km with a battery pack rated at 50.3 kWh. It gets a 176 hp motor that enables it to accelerate from 0-100 kmph in less than 9 seconds. The ZS EV can be charged in a number of ways, including an onboard charging cable, AC fast chargers, DC super fast chargers at MG dealerships, the public charging network, and roadside assistance. While the ZS EV’s safety features include six airbags, TPMS, ESP, HLA, HDC, EPB, blind spot detection system, pedestrian detection system, rear cross traffic alert, and ISOFIX mounts.
